Attached is a patch which corrects the problem with my ports.

I am unable to discover the cause of the following, however:

dallben# make USE_X_PREFIX=YES install
===>  Installing for linux-flashplugin-6.0r79_2
===>   linux-flashplugin-6.0r79_2 depends on file: /compat/linux/etc/redhat-release - found
===>   linux-flashplugin-6.0r79_2 depends on shared library: X11.6 - found
===>   Generating temporary packing list
===>  Checking if www/linux-flashplugin6 already installed
===>   Registering installation for linux-flashplugin-6.0r79_2
make: Max recursion level (500) exceeded.: Resource temporarily unavailable
dallben#

Does anyone see anything in my ports which would cause this behavior?
The port installs correctly despite this error message.
